
How to Make Hot Cocoa with Cocoa Powder: A Step-by-Step Guide
As the temperature drops and the cozy season approaches, nothing warms the heart quite like a steaming cup of hot cocoa. Unlike hot chocolate, which is made from melted chocolate, hot cocoa is crafted using cocoa powder, resulting in a lighter yet equally delicious beverage. In this article, we’ll explore how to make hot cocoa with cocoa powder, answer common questions about the process, and share tips for customization.

In your saucepan, mix together 2 tablespoons of sugar and 1 tablespoon of cocoa powder. If you like a sweeter cocoa, feel free to adjust the sugar to taste. Adding a pinch of salt can enhance the chocolate flavor.
Add 1-2 tablespoons of milk to the dry mixture. Stir well until it forms a smooth paste. This step is crucial as it helps to dissolve the cocoa powder and sugar, preventing lumps in your hot cocoa.
Gradually add the rest of your milk (about 1 cup) to the saucepan. Heat the mixture over medium heat, stirring continuously. Be careful not to let it boil, as this can affect the texture of your cocoa.
Once the milk is hot, remove the saucepan from the heat. Stir in 1/4 teaspoon of vanilla extract for a hint of flavor. If you want to get creative, consider adding a sprinkle of cinnamon or a few chocolate chips for extra richness.
Pour the hot cocoa into your favorite mug. Top it off with whipped cream, marshmallows, or chocolate shavings for a delightful finishing touch. Enjoy your homemade hot cocoa while curled up on the couch!

To make hot cocoa, you'll need unsweetened cocoa powder, sugar, milk (any type you prefer), and optional ingredients like salt, vanilla extract, or spices such as cinnamon.
To prevent lumps, start by mixing 2 tablespoons of sugar and 1 tablespoon of cocoa powder in a saucepan. Then, add 1-2 tablespoons of milk to create a smooth paste before gradually adding the rest of the milk.
Yes! You can customize your hot cocoa by adjusting the sweetness, using dairy-free milk alternatives, or adding flavor extras like peppermint extract or a dash of espresso for a mocha twist.
For a gathering, you can make a larger batch of hot cocoa and keep it warm in a slow cooker. Offer various toppings like whipped cream, marshmallows, or chocolate shavings for guests to personalize their drinks.
